Top Locations Tagged with Factory kozhikode india

Factory kozhikode india in India - 673001/ near kozhikode

Factory kozhikode india in India - 673004/ near kozhikode

Factory kozhikode india in India - 673303/ near kozhikode

Factory kozhikode india in India - 673633/ near kozhikode

Factory kozhikode india in India - 673018/ near kozhikode

Factory kozhikode india in India - 673001/ near kozhikode

Factory kozhikode india in India - 673032/ near kozhikode

Factory kozhikode india in India - 673014/ near kozhikode

Factory kozhikode india in India - 673003/ near kozhikode

Factory kozhikode india in India - 673571/ near kozhikode

Factory kozhikode india in India - 673004/ near kozhikode

Factory kozhikode india in India - 673580/ near kozhikode

Factory kozhikode india in India - 673008/ near kozhikode